The world's most punctual airlines in 2022 were
This week we've seen air passengers stranded in the Philippines after a power outage, flight delays in Florida and Denver, as well as the ongoing saga of Southwest Airlines' winter holiday meltdown. Welcome to 2023, where an airline actually being punctual is headline news. The airline in question is South American carrier Azul Brazilian Airlines, which last year had the best on-time performance globally, according to a new report by aviation analytics firm Cirium. During what was a particularly chaotic 12 months for aviation, Azul Brazilian operated nearly 280,000 flights last year and 88.93% of them arrived within 15 minutes of its scheduled time at the gate -- Cirium's performance measure. Elsewhere in South America, Chile's LATAM Airlines (86.31% punctuality across more than 450,000 flights) took fourth place on Cirium's ranking of international airlines and Colombia's Avianca (83.48% and nearly 145,000 flights) was sixth. The United States was also well represented, both for airlines and airports. For the second year in a row, Delta Airlines was given the Cirium Platinum Award for global operational excellence, which weighs up punctuality alongside operational complexity and an airline's ability to limit the impact of flight disruption to its passengers.
